Euro cylinder locks can come in various different key and lock styles, … WebRegardless the door needs to be square before the latch is adjusted. With the door perfectly square, take a piece of masking tape and align it at the top of the opening in the latch keeper mounted on the side jamb. Wrap the tape around the inside so you can see the level of the top edge even when the door is closed.

Lubricate door hinges, rollers (except nylon rollers), sheave bearings, torsion springs and the lift cables at the bottom corners of the door annually with Clopay Pro-Lube. Lubricant allows door hardware to work smoothly and correctly.
